[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

RE: errores de autenticacion NTLM+SQUID3 despues de actualizacion



 

Hola, creo que esto no ha llegado, lo he enviado al poco de darme de alta e igual me he dado demasiada prisa, si si que habia llegado pido disculpas.

 

De paso una aclaracion, el archivo en la pagina me lo descarga como tmp.diff.txt, no se si tengo que renombrarlo como ntlm_auth.c.diff. Yo en el servidor tengo la carpeta ntlm_auth, y dentro:

 

fake  

Makefile.am 

Makefile.in 

modules.m4 

smb_lm 

SSPI

 

pero no localizo ningun ntlm_auth.c

 

Esto es lo que pone dentro del tmp.diff.txt (referente a los ficheros, poner pone mucho mas)

--- a/source3/utils/ntlm_auth.c
+++ b/source3/utils/ntlm_auth.c

Gracias, Laura

 

De: Laura Marzà Porcar
Enviado el: lunes, 05 de septiembre de 2016 11:37
Para: 'debian-user-spanish@lists.debian.org'
Asunto: errores de autenticacion NTLM+SQUID3 despues de actualizacion

 

Hola, había configurado squid3 (versión 3.4.8) para funcionar con autenticación NTLM contra un active directory, estaba funcionando bien, había configurado ya varias restricciones de acceso en active y squid, pero actualice para depurar algunos errores que me aparecían al acceder a algunas páginas y ahora no puedo validar los usuarios, me aparece el siguiente error:

 

2016/09/05 11:04:18| negotiate_wrapper: received type 3 NTLM token

Got user=[MIUSUARIO] domain=[MIDOMINIO] workstation=[MIEQUIPO] len1=24 len2=404

2016/09/05 11:04:18| negotiate_wrapper: Error reading NTLM helper response

2016/09/05 11:04:18.793 kid1| WARNING: negotiateauthenticator #Hlpr0 exited

2016/09/05 11:04:18.793 kid1| Too few negotiateauthenticator processes are running (need 1/20)

2016/09/05 11:04:18.793 kid1| Starting new helpers

2016/09/05 11:04:18.793 kid1| helperOpenServers: Starting 1/20 'negotiate_wrapper' processes

2016/09/05 11:04:18.793 kid1| ERROR: Negotiate Authentication Helper '0xb829a0d8/0xb829a0d8' crashed!.

2016/09/05 11:04:18.793 kid1| ERROR: Negotiate Authentication validating user. Result: {result=Unknown}

2016/09/05 11:04:18| negotiate_wrapper: Starting version 1.0

2016/09/05 11:04:18| negotiate_wrapper: NTLM command: /usr/bin/ntlm_auth --diagnostics --helper-protocol=squid-2.5-ntlmssp --domain=MIDOMINIO

2016/09/05 11:04:18| negotiate_wrapper: Kerberos command: /usr/local/bin/squid_kerb_auth -d -s GSS_C_NO_NAME

2016/09/05 11:04:18| squid_kerb_auth: Starting version 1.0.7

 

 

En SQUID3, la validación la hago de la siguiente manera (que hasta el otro dia que actualicé me había funcionado):

 

auth_param negotiate program /usr/local/bin/negotiate_wrapper -d --ntlm /usr/bin/ntlm_auth --diagnostics --helper-protocol=squid-2.5-ntlmssp --domain=MIDOMINIO

auth_param ntlm children 30

auth_param ntlm keep_alive off

 

He estado mirando por la web y he leido algo sobre la instalación de un parche que soluciona el problema (https://bugzilla.samba.org/show_bug.cgi?id=11914), pero no se como aplicar esto, básicamente es que no se como empezar ¿Cómo descargo este parche?, una vez tuviese el parche descargado ya es cuestión de buscar como se aplica, pero es que lo absurdo es no se como debo descargarlo o guardarlo.

 

Gracias, Laura

 


Reply to: